APCOA PCN Heathrow drop off

Background:

I recently dropped off family at Terminal 5.  I did not realize I could not pay on site, and then I assumed I would receive a £5 bill which I would pay when I got the bill.  Instead I received a £40/£80 PCN instead.

I came on here and read what I could find.

I copied and submitted the blue text from the NEWBIES thread (and declined to name the driver), so hopefully that works.

If not, I have the POPLA wordage loaded into a PDF and ready to go.

I did come across some threads of people saying APCOA rejected their appeal but failed to notify them and failed to give them a POPLA number for further appeal - is there any way to head off that type of scenario before it materializes?
